Central Vein Sign and Paramagnetic Rim Lesions: Susceptibility Changes in Brain Tissues and Their Implications for the Study of Multiple Sclerosis Pathology
Multiple sclerosis (MS) is the most common acquired inflammatory and demyelinating disease in adults.
